This might be useful, too. The Britannia Hotel has come to an arrangement with the NCP car park on St James Street to offer cheap parking to attendees of FantasyCon: just £5 per 24 hours, a substantial saving on the usual rates. Note that it's a one-time ticket, the special rate lasting only as long as the car remains in the carpark. To take advantage of this offer, ask for the ticket at the reception desk of the Britannia upon your arrival. Note that there are only 70 such tickets available, and they cannot be booked in advance. |
